Question 228: To ask the Minister for Health and Children if her attention has been drawn to the fact that the budget of an association (details supplied) was cut by the Health Service Executive in 2008; and if she has proposals to remedy this funding shortfall; and if she will make a statement on the matter. Mary Harney (Dublin Mid West, Progressive Democrats)
Link to this: Individually | In context
Under the Health Act 2004, responsibility for the funding of voluntary organisations which are involved in the provision of health and personal social services rests with the Health Service Executive. Accordingly, my Department has requested the Parliamentary Affairs Division of the Executive to arrange to have the specific matter investigated and to have a reply issued directly to the Deputy.
